1. Reasonable exposure to lightThe weeping angel needs a certain amount of soft scattered light during its growth. If it is not exposed to light for a long time, the leaves will lose their vitality and naturally become soft and drooping. It can be exposed to sunlight appropriately and placed in a well-lit place for maintenance, but it cannot be exposed to strong light to avoid sunburn.2. Appropriate fertilizationThe weeping angel likes fertilizer. If it lacks nutrients, its growth will be affected and the leaves will lose vitality. It is necessary to apply nutrient solution once a month to ensure that nutrients are supplied, and the leaves will become green and vibrant again.3. Clean the bladesThe leaves may become soft because a large amount of dust has accumulated on the leaves, affecting photosynthesis, covering the stomata on the leaves, causing them to droop and become soft. The leaves need to be cleaned and sprayed with water regularly.4. Proper pruningIf the leaves become soft, it may be that the petiole is too long and cannot support the weight, causing it to droop. You can trim it appropriately and shorten the petiole to ensure later growth.5. BundlingYou can tie the leaves up with a cloth strip, insert a bamboo pole, and fix it on the pole to make the leaves stand up. This will prevent the leaves from drooping down. |
